Thesis Details
Distribuovaný řídicí systém s dynamicky modifikovatelnými uzly na platformě RPi Zero
Bachelor's Thesis
Student: Szymik Michal
Academic Year: 2020/2021
Supervisor: Janoušek Vladimír, doc. Ing., Ph.D.
English title
Distributed Control System with Dynamically Evolvable Nodes on RPi Zero Platform
Language
Czech
Abstract
This work focuses on the development of a distributed control system that runs on multiple Raspberry Pi Zero devices and enables dynamic reconfiguration of its topology. The platform is implemented in Python in the form of a runtime environment. This work also describes how to develop applications for this system and introduces a script that facilitates the installation of an application onto the system nodes. The system described works and a sample application demonstrates its functionality.
Keywords
Raspberry Pi Zero, Python, MQTT, DCS, PLC, SCADA, Node-RED
Department
Degree Programme
Information Technology
Files
Status
defended, grade B
Date
17 June 2021
Reviewer
Committee
Janoušek Vladimír, doc. Ing., Ph.D. (DITS FIT BUT), předseda
Mrázek Vojtěch, Ing., Ph.D. (DCSY FIT BUT), člen
Rozman Jaroslav, Ing., Ph.D. (DITS FIT BUT), člen
Mrázek Vojtěch, Ing., Ph.D. (DCSY FIT BUT), člen
Rozman Jaroslav, Ing., Ph.D. (DITS FIT BUT), člen
Citation
SZYMIK, Michal. Distribuovaný řídicí systém s dynamicky modifikovatelnými uzly na platformě RPi Zero. Brno, 2021. Bachelor's Thesis. Brno University of Technology, Faculty of Information Technology. 2021-06-17. Supervised by Janoušek Vladimír. Available from: https://www.fit.vut.cz/study/thesis/22485/
BibTeX
@bachelorsthesis{FITBT22485, author = "Michal Szymik", type = "Bachelor's thesis", title = "Distribuovan\'{y} \v{r}\'{i}dic\'{i} syst\'{e}m s dynamicky modifikovateln\'{y}mi uzly na platform\v{e} RPi Zero", school = "Brno University of Technology, Faculty of Information Technology", year = 2021, location = "Brno, CZ", language = "czech", url = "https://www.fit.vut.cz/study/thesis/22485/" }